云服务器怎么架设网站,云服务器搭建网站教程,从入门到精通的详细步骤解析
- 综合资讯
- 2025-03-18 19:46:15
- 2

云服务器架设网站教程,涵盖从入门到精通的详细步骤,包括选择云服务器、配置环境、安装软件、部署网站、优化性能等关键环节,助您轻松搭建并管理云上网站。...
云服务器架设网站教程,涵盖从入门到精通的详细步骤,包括选择云服务器、配置环境、安装软件、部署网站、优化性能等关键环节,助您轻松搭建并管理云上网站。
随着互联网的快速发展,越来越多的企业和个人选择将网站部署在云服务器上,云服务器具有稳定性高、扩展性强、成本较低等优点,因此成为搭建网站的首选平台,本文将详细讲解如何在云服务器上搭建网站,从入门到精通,让您轻松掌握网站搭建技巧。
准备工作
图片来源于网络,如有侵权联系删除
-
云服务器:选择一家可靠的云服务提供商,如阿里云、腾讯云、华为云等,购买一台云服务器。
-
域名:购买一个适合自己网站的域名,并解析到云服务器ip地址。
-
网络工具:安装FTP客户端、SSH客户端等网络工具,用于文件传输和远程操作。
-
常用软件:安装操作系统(如Linux、Windows)、数据库(如MySQL、MongoDB)、服务器软件(如Apache、Nginx)等。
搭建网站详细步骤
安装操作系统
以Linux系统为例,登录云服务器后,使用以下命令安装操作系统:
sudo apt-get update
sudo apt-get install -y openssh-server
配置防火墙
打开防火墙,允许HTTP和HTTPS访问:
sudo ufw allow 'Nginx Full'
sudo ufw allow 'Apache Full'
安装Web服务器
以Nginx为例,安装Nginx服务器:
sudo apt-get install -y nginx
启动Nginx服务:
sudo systemctl start nginx
设置Nginx服务开机自启:
sudo systemctl enable nginx
安装数据库
以MySQL为例,安装MySQL数据库:
sudo apt-get install -y mysql-server
配置MySQL密码,并设置root用户远程登录权限:
图片来源于网络,如有侵权联系删除
sudo mysql_secure_installation
安装应用程序
以WordPress为例,安装WordPress应用程序:
(1)下载WordPress压缩包:https://wordpress.org/download/
(2)使用FTP客户端将压缩包上传到云服务器上的指定目录,如/var/www/html/
(3)解压WordPress压缩包
(4)打开浏览器,访问http://你的域名
,按照提示进行安装
配置网站
(1)配置域名解析:将域名解析到云服务器IP地址
(2)配置SSL证书:购买SSL证书,并上传到云服务器
(3)配置数据库:在WordPress安装过程中,设置数据库主机、数据库名、用户名和密码等信息
网站优化
(1)优化Nginx配置:修改Nginx配置文件,如/etc/nginx/sites-available/your-site
(2)优化数据库:定期备份数据库,并对数据库进行优化
(3)优化网站代码:对网站代码进行压缩、合并等操作,提高网站加载速度
通过以上步骤,您已经成功在云服务器上搭建了一个网站,在实际运营过程中,还需不断优化网站,提高用户体验,希望本文能帮助您快速入门云服务器搭建网站,祝您网站运营顺利!
本文链接:https://www.zhitaoyun.cn/1828087.html
发表评论